The Direct Answer: Changing Your Zoom Name

The quickest way to change your name on Zoom depends on when you want to do it: before joining a meeting, during a meeting, or permanently for future meetings.

  • Before Joining a Meeting: When you click on a Zoom meeting link, you’ll be prompted to enter your name. Simply type in your desired name in the designated field. Make sure to check the box that says “Remember my name for future meetings” if you want Zoom to retain this name.

  • During a Meeting: Hover over your video tile. Click the “…” (ellipsis) icon that appears in the top right corner. Select “Rename.” Type in your new name and click “Rename.” This change will only apply to the current meeting unless you check the box indicating you want to save the name for future meetings (if this option is available).

  • Changing Your Profile Name (Permanent Change): Sign in to the Zoom web portal. Click “Profile” in the navigation menu. Under your name, click “Edit” to the right. Enter your desired first and last name. Click “Save.” This will change your name for all future meetings you host or join while logged in.

FAQ 1: Can I change my name multiple times during the same meeting?

Yes, you can typically change your name as many times as you like during a Zoom meeting, provided the host hasn’t disabled the ability for participants to rename themselves. Just follow the steps for changing your name during a meeting each time you want to make a change.

FAQ 2: How do I change my name on the Zoom mobile app?

The process is similar on the Zoom mobile app (iOS and Android):

  • Before Joining: Enter your name in the prompt before joining the meeting and choose to remember it.
  • During the Meeting: Tap the “Participants” icon. Find your name in the participant list, and tap on it. Select “Rename.” Enter your new name and tap “OK.”
  • Profile Change: Tap “More” (three dots) at the bottom right. Tap your name. Tap “Display Name.” Enter your new name and tap “Save.”

FAQ 3: What if the “Rename” option is greyed out during a meeting?

If the “Rename” option is greyed out, it means the meeting host has disabled the ability for participants to rename themselves. You’ll need to ask the host to either change your name for you or enable the renaming function.

FAQ 4: How can a host change a participant’s name?

A host can change a participant’s name by:

  1. Clicking “Participants” in the meeting controls.
  2. Hovering over the participant’s name they want to change.
  3. Clicking “More.”
  4. Selecting “Rename.”
  5. Entering the new name and clicking “Rename.”

This is useful for correcting misspelled names or enforcing a consistent naming convention.

FAQ 5: Does changing my name on Zoom change my name on my Zoom account?

Changing your name during a meeting usually doesn’t change your name on your Zoom account profile permanently, unless you specifically choose to save it when prompted. To permanently change your name for all future meetings, you must update your profile as described above.

FAQ 6: What if I’m using a web browser to join a Zoom meeting?

The process for changing your name in a web browser is essentially the same as using the desktop app. You’ll be prompted to enter your name before joining. During the meeting, hover over your video, click the ellipsis, and choose “Rename.”

FAQ 7: Can I use special characters or emojis in my Zoom name?

Yes, you can generally use special characters and emojis in your Zoom name. However, keep in mind that some characters might not display correctly for all participants, depending on their operating system and Zoom version. Choose wisely and ensure clarity for everyone.

FAQ 8: I’m signed in with SSO (Single Sign-On). How do I change my name?

If you’re using SSO, your Zoom name may be tied to your organization’s directory. Changing your name directly in Zoom might not be possible. You may need to contact your IT administrator to update your name in the organization’s directory.

FAQ 9: How do I prevent people from seeing my email address on Zoom?

Zoom, by default, shows your display name rather than your email address to other participants. To ensure your email is hidden:

  • Use a Display Name: Always set a display name that you want others to see.
  • Don’t Share Your Screen: Be cautious about sharing your entire screen, especially if your email client or other applications displaying your email address are open.

FAQ 10: Can I set a different name for each Zoom meeting?

Unfortunately, Zoom doesn’t offer a feature to save multiple names and choose one for each meeting. However, you can always change your name before or during each meeting as needed. The key is to be mindful of which name is currently displayed.

FAQ 11: My company has a specific naming convention for Zoom meetings. How can I easily comply?

The easiest way to comply is to create a reminder for yourself to change your name before joining each meeting, following the established convention. If your company uses SSO and has specific naming policies, your IT department should implement configurations to automatically enforce these policies.

FAQ 12: What happens if I don’t change my name and it’s incorrect?

If your name is incorrect, you might cause confusion among participants, especially in larger meetings. You might also miss out on important interactions if people misidentify you. It’s always best to ensure your name is accurate and reflects how you want to be addressed.
